Joe is the Founder and President of Life Values Financial in Crofton, MD, and a Registered Representative with United Planners Financial Services. Since starting his firm in 2000, Joe has built his practice on faith-based principles, serving his clients’ financial needs from a Christian/Catholic perspective. Joe is a Certified Financial Planner (CFP®) and holds the FINRA Series 7, 63, and 65 licenses (securities through United Planners and advisory services through Stewardship Advisory Group), as well as Life and Health Insurance licenses. As an Enrolled Agent (EA), Joe is also licensed to represent taxpayers before the IRS.

When he is not wearing his financial planning hat, Joe enjoys spending time with his wife of 6 years, Sarah, and his two-year-old daughter. He is an accomplished pianist, having recorded two CDs of original piano solos, and is an accompanist at two different churches on the weekends. Joe also enjoys playing several sports, including basketball and baseball.
